Cassino. / (Italian kassino) / noun. a town in central Italy, in Latium at the foot of Monte Cassino: an ancient Volscian (and later Roman) town and citadel. cassino in British English\n\n or casino (kYsinY ) noun. a card game for two to four players in which players pair cards from their hands with others exposed on the table. Casinos, cardrooms and poker rooms make money from poker by taking a rake, entry fee or timed fee from the players. In poker cash games, the casino often takes a rake from every poker hand in the room. If a poker room hosts 30 cash games, the casino can profit substantially from this.
